How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Barclay?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Barclay Studio Apartments | $1,404 | $600 | $2,693 |
| Barclay 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,658 | $500 | $4,302 |
Barclay 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,000 | $949 | $5,541 |
| Barclay 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,110 | $1,040 | $4,715 |
| Barclay 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,858 | $1,000 | $3,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Barclay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Barclay with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Barclay is at Penn Square listed at $768.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Barclay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Barclay is $2,000.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Barclay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Barclay is a 1,900 square feet unit starting from $2,300 at The Railway Express Loft Apartments.
What is the average size for Barclay 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Barclay is currently 1,076 sq ft.
